Summary: John Ford weaves three "Judge Priest" stories together to form a good- natured exploration of honour and small-town politics in the South around the turn of the century. Judge William Priest is involved variously in revealing the real identity of Lucy Lake, reliving his Civil War memories, preventing the lynching of a youth and contesting the elections with Yankee Horace K. Maydew. (imdb)

Probably my favorite Ford film. I loved Judge Priest, which Ford made 20 years earlier with Will Rogers, but the formal control Ford exercises in this film is outstanding even by his standards. The film includes what to my mind is the greatest sequence in any Ford film, a funeral procession that proceeds largely without dialogue for several minutes, ending with a sermon at the church. The poetry of Ford's cinema is never clearer than in this scene. Beautiful and humane.

Ford wants us to treat blacks as equals, but paints them in ugly stereotypes, ridiculous caricatures who have no ambition but servitude to their white superiors. I kept waiting for one of them to blurt out "I sho do love me some white folk!". The white characters aren't much better, and tend towards either "annoying" or "bland". And then there's the usual sentimental hooey about God and country. There's a few good scenes, but Ford's predilection for myth-making taints even those.
